§ 1-2c — Construction of term “electronic mail”.

Text
Wherever in the general statutes or public acts the term “electronic mail” is used, such term shall be deemed to include an electronic delivery service that delivers communications to their intended recipients by matching an electronic mail address to a person's United States Postal Service physical address and uses security methods such as passwords or encryption.

Legislative History
(P.A. 12-185, S. 1.)
